Maloney is probably DP quality from 3 years ago, he isn't DP quality in my mind anymore. He is probably just a top player as opposed to a star. Your DP in theory is a star that you can only afford if his salary can't fit into the salary cap. Maloneys salary can fit into the salary cap so he shouldn't be a DP player. Getting to far into other teams or Chicago should probably be left to the MLS thread if you want to post in it. But yea Maloney could probably do a job for us, but he isn't the level of player that the DP is supposed to be.

I don't think the MLS has a formal transfer request system like in Europe and I can't find it on google. I'm sure he can tell them he wants to leave but I don't think he can force their hand on it. They can sell him to us after their window closes on Thursday as it's our window that matters when selling a player outside of their league.
